#6b9a99 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6b9a99 is composed of 42% red, 60.4%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 0.6%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 178.7 degrees, a saturation of 18.9% and a lightness of 51.2%. #6b9a99 color hex could be obtained by blending #d6ffff with #003533.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#6b9a99 color description : Mostly desaturated dark cyan.

#6b9a99 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6b9a99 has RGB values of R:107, G:154, B:153 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 7051929.

Shades and Tints of #6b9a99

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020404 is the darkest color, while #f7f9f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6b9a99

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e8787 is the less saturated color, while #0bfaf5 is the most saturated one.
